Curious about the amazing moment when a fluffy chick emerges from its shell? The timeframe it takes for a chicken egg to break out is typically around 21. This process starts with a fertilized egg being placed under a broody hen or in an incubator. The chick inside will develop steadily, transforming bigger and more active as the days go by. Around day 18, you might notice faint chirping sounds – a sure sign that pipping is near!

  • Keep in mind that each chick has its own timeline
  • The chirping noises signal that hatching is imminent

Once the chick hatches, it needs warmth, food, and water. Enjoy watching your new flock grow and thrive!

From Ocean to Pantry: The Benefits of Dried Pollock

Dried pollock, a simple catch from the depths of the ocean, can enhance your culinary creations in surprising ways. This inexpensive and nutritious fish undergoes a unique drying process that intensifies its bold flavor profile.

From savory soups to hearty stews, dried pollock adds a depth of umami unmatched by fresh counterparts. Its consistency makes it an ideal ingredient for thickening sauces and adding substance to dishes.

  • Furthermore, dried pollock is a valuable source of essential nutrients such as vitamin B12, selenium, and omega-3 fatty acids.
  • Recognized as a pantry staple in many cultures, it offers a practical way to enjoy the benefits of this nutritious fish year-round.

Unlocking the Flavor: Recipes with Dried Pollock

Dried pollock, a key ingredient in many Asian cuisines, offers a unique and savory flavor profile that can elevate your culinary creations. This versatile fish, typically dried and salted for preservation, becomes tender and flavorful when rehydrated and incorporated into dishes. From comforting stews to vibrant stir-fries, dried pollock adds depth and complexity to your cooking.

Here are some tips to unlock the full potential of dried pollock in your kitchen:

* Begin by submerging the dried pollock in warm water for several hours until it is soft and pliable.

* Experiment with different seasonings and spices to create a flavor profile that suits your taste. Popular choices include ginger, garlic, chili flakes, and soy sauce.

* Incorporate rehydrated pollock into traditional Asian dishes like kimchi jjigae (kimchi stew), japchae (glass noodle stir-fry), or tteokbokki (spicy rice cakes).

* For a quick and easy meal, include cooked dried pollock to your favorite soups or salads for an added boost of protein and flavor.

By embracing the unique qualities of dried pollock, you can discover a world of delicious culinary possibilities.
